The Resource Review page provides a centralized view of Resource allocation (effort) and availability across work items, as well as any unstaffed demand that currently exists.
The Allocation section (top section) displays PowerSteering Resources, as well as their current time assigned to work items ("Effort") and available time ("Availability"). "Effort" refers to the amount of Resource time that is assigned or allocated to PowerSteering work. It is the result of assigning Resources to work using Project Central. "Availability" refers to the amount of available time a Resource still has during the time period. This time can be allocated to PowerSteering work.
The Resources and work items displayed on the Resource Review page are a result of the filters that have been placed on the allocation section of the selected Resource Review Layout. The filters have a significant effect on each Resource's effort and availability, including whether you are viewing a Resource's true effort/availability or only effort/availability toward work items in the selected Portfolio.
Note: The Allocation section can display 500 Resources at one time. If the filter results exceed this number, you will be prompted to revise the filter criteria. This threshold works for each filter independently, so if at least one of the filter's results exceeds 500 Resources, you will be prompted with the warning and further filtering will stop.

To filter the Allocation section:
Before You Start: All PowerSteering users can access the Resource Review page. However, users can only view the data through Resource Review Layouts they have saved themselves or that have been shared with all users. Additionally, users can only view work items and users that they have permission to view. For instance, users without the "View" Project Task permission on a work item will not be able to view the work item on the Resource Review page:

Resource pool
Use the drop-down menu to determine which Resource Pools will be displayed. Alternatively, select the blank space to ignore the filter.
-
Any value: Resources that belong to any Resource Pool will be included.
-
No value: Resources that do not belong to a Resource Pool will be included.
-
Select values: Select which Resource Pools will be included:
Role
These drop-down menus can be used to filter the Resources by their Role.
The first drop-down menu determines whether the selected Role should be on the Resource's Profile or on the work they are assigned to:
-
On profile: Resources with the selected Role(s) on their profile will be included.
Note: All of the Resource's work will be included in the Resource Review. This will give the Resource's full effort and availability for the selected period. If you do not want to display all of the Resource's work, consider selecting "On profile only" instead.
-
On profile only : Resources with the selected Role(s) on their profile will be displayed. Only work that they are assigned to under the specified Role(s) will appear.
-
On work: Resources with the selected Role(s) on the work they are assigned to will be included.
Note: All of the Resource's work will be included, not just the Resource's work on the work item(s) in which they have the designated Role(s). This will give the Resource's full effort and availability for the selected period. If you do not want to display all of the Resource's work, consider selecting "On work only" instead.
-
On work only: Resources assigned to work under the selected Role(s) will be displayed. Only work that they are assigned to under the specified Role(s) will appear.
-
Either role or work: Resources with the selected Role(s) on either their profile or the work they are assigned to will be included.
Note: All of the Resource's work will be included, not just the Resource's work on the work item(s) in which they have the designated Role(s). This will give the Resource's full effort and availability for the selected period.
The second drop-down menu determines the actual Roles that will be included:
-
Any value: Any Resources with a Role will be included (on the Resource's profile or work, based on the selection in the first drop-down menu).
-
Select values: Resources with the selected Role(s) will be included (if the Role is on the Resource's profile or work, based on the selection in the first drop-down menu):
Users & Groups
Select the drop-down menu to only include selected users or groups:
Allocated to work on portfolio
When a Portfolio is selected from this drop-down menu, all of the work and Resources associated with items in that selected Portfolio will be included.
Note: If the "Include projects from outside the portfolio" checkbox (below) is selected and a Resource has work assigned to them that is not part of the selected Portfolio, but is within the selected time frame, it will also be displayed to give the full picture of that Resource's effort and availability for the period. The display will also include dependent descendant works.
Include projects from outside the portfolio
When this is selected, non-Portfolio work items will be displayed for Resources if they have allocations toward them within the time period. If this is not selected, however, non-Portfolio work items will be completely filtered out of the Resource Review. Only Resource allocations toward work items in the selected Portfolio will be displayed.
Allocated to project
When work is selected from the window that appears, all of the work and Resources associated with it will be included.
Note: If a Resource has work assigned to them that is not part of the selected work, but is within the selected time frame, it will also be displayed to give the full picture of that Resource's effort and availability for the period. The display will also include dependent descendant works.
